What are Senior Clubs?

Senior clubs are organizations designed specifically for older adults to come together and participate in various activities that contribute to their social, physical, and mental well-being. These clubs not only foster friendships but also support personal growth through engaging programs. From organized outings, fitness classes, to social gatherings, these clubs can be a fantastic platform for connection and fun. Many clubs are located within retirement communities or even stand-alone entities, providing a flexibility that seniors love.

Activities Focused on Memory Care

For seniors dealing with cognitive challenges, senior clubs provide specific memory care and dementia care activities that cater to their needs. These activities are often engaged in tandem with caregivers, ensuring a supportive and nurturing environment. Examples may include brain games, memory-boosting exercises, and recalling past experiences through storytelling sessions, allowing seniors to embrace their memories while engaging socially.

Engaging Fitness Classes

Exercise doesn’t have to be daunting! Many senior clubs offer fitness classes that focus on gentle movements and flexibility. From chair yoga to water aerobics, these sessions are designed to keep the body active and healthy while ensuring safety. Regular physical activity is known to enhance not only physical but also mental health, reducing risks related to age-related illnesses.
